Job summary
Excellent opportunity has arisen for an experienced HR practitioner to take on the role of Deputy HR Business Partner to the Family and Specialist Services and Corporate Services Divisions at the Royal United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ust. The successful post holder will be key in providing dedicated HR support to designated areas within the organisation ensuring the provision of high quality operational support as well as the delivery of organisational change programmes across the Trust.
You will work flexibly, in line with the overall needs of the operational HR team. This is a busy, dynamic role with excellent support from the HR Business Partner and the overall HR Operational team. We all pride ourselves on providing a professional, pro-active and person-centered HR service, in line with the Restorative Just Learning Culture principles.
You will hold the post-graduate level 7 CIPD qualification (or be working towards it) and have significant operational experience that includes managing organisational change programmes alongside employee relations cases through to dismissal. Experience of coaching and developing managers in effective people management is essential as is highly effective communication and interpersonal skills.

Main duties of the job
- Provide high quality advice on all HR issues in specified areas, and working with the relevant HR Business Partner/HR Manager, ensuring there is the best people management practice, including workforce management and development and employee relations in all designated areas.
- With the HR Business partner to be a key member of the divisional management team, acting as an effective "business partner" providing high quality advice and challenge to influence improvements to increase the efficiency, effectiveness and competiveness of the Division and coaching managers to improve their leadership and people management skills.
- To work on specific delegated corporate HR projects in line with the HR Directorate business plan.
- To act as a role model within the HR team and for the team both within the trust and externally, demonstrating the trust values at all times. To develop and maintain effective working relationships at all levels of the organisation including at the senior level.
- To undertake education and development responsibilities including the support of the delivery of management development courses and general induction.
